イーサクラシック(ETC)の取引でよくある失敗と対策
イーサクラシック(ETC:EtherCAT Technology)は、産業用イーサネットにおける高性能な通信プロトコルとして、FA(ファクトリーオートメーション)分野を中心に広く採用されています。その高速性、リアルタイム性、柔軟性から、様々なアプリケーションで利用されていますが、ETCの取引(導入、設定、運用)においては、いくつかの潜在的な失敗リスクが存在します。本稿では、ETC取引でよくある失敗事例を詳細に分析し、それぞれの対策について専門的な視点から解説します。
1. 事前調査・要件定義の不備
ETC導入における最初の段階である事前調査と要件定義は、プロジェクトの成否を大きく左右します。不十分な調査は、後々のトラブルの原因となります。
1.1 ネットワーク構成の誤解
ETCは、ライン型トポロジーを基本としますが、スター型やリング型など、様々な構成が可能です。しかし、ネットワーク構成を誤ると、通信速度の低下や通信エラーが発生する可能性があります。特に、ネットワークの物理的な距離やノード数、使用するケーブルの種類などを考慮せずに構成を決定すると、性能が期待通りに発揮されないことがあります。事前にネットワークシミュレーションを行い、最適な構成を検討することが重要です。
1.2 必要な帯域幅の過小評価
ETCは、高速なデータ転送を可能にしますが、必要な帯域幅を過小評価すると、ボトルネックが発生し、リアルタイム性が損なわれる可能性があります。各ノードから送信されるデータの量、更新周期、通信の優先度などを詳細に分析し、十分な帯域幅を確保する必要があります。また、将来的な拡張性も考慮し、余裕を持った設計を行うことが望ましいです。
1.3 互換性の確認不足
ETCは、様々なメーカーから提供されており、それぞれの製品には独自の機能や特性があります。異なるメーカーのデバイスを組み合わせる場合、互換性の問題が発生する可能性があります。事前に、各デバイスの仕様書を確認し、互換性を確認する必要があります。また、メーカーに問い合わせて、互換性に関する情報を収集することも有効です。
2. ハードウェア選定の誤り
ETCシステムを構成するハードウェアの選定は、システムの性能と信頼性に直接影響します。不適切なハードウェアを選定すると、期待通りの性能が得られないだけでなく、故障のリスクも高まります。
2.1 ETCコントローラの性能不足
ETCコントローラは、ETCネットワークの中核となるデバイスであり、その性能はシステム全体の性能に大きく影響します。コントローラの処理能力、メモリ容量、ポート数などを、システムの要件に合わせて適切に選定する必要があります。特に、多数のノードを接続する場合や、複雑な制御を行う場合は、高性能なコントローラを選定することが重要です。
2.2 ケーブルの品質不良
ETCは、高速なデータ転送を行うため、ケーブルの品質が非常に重要です。低品質なケーブルを使用すると、信号の減衰やノイズの影響を受けやすく、通信エラーが発生する可能性があります。カテゴリ5e以上のケーブルを使用し、適切なシールド処理を施すことが重要です。また、ケーブルの長さも考慮し、必要に応じてリピータを使用する必要があります。
2.3 電源供給の不安定さ
ETCデバイスは、安定した電源供給が必要です。電源供給が不安定な場合、誤動作や故障の原因となります。UPS(無停電電源装置)を導入し、電源供給の安定化を図ることが望ましいです。また、電源ケーブルの接続状態を確認し、緩みがないことを確認することも重要です。
3. ソフトウェア設定の不備
ETCシステムのソフトウェア設定は、システムの動作を制御する上で非常に重要です。不適切な設定を行うと、通信エラーや誤動作が発生する可能性があります。
3.1 ネットワークパラメータの設定ミス
ETCネットワークを構成する各デバイスには、IPアドレス、サブネットマスク、ゲートウェイなどのネットワークパラメータを設定する必要があります。これらのパラメータを誤って設定すると、通信が確立できなくなる可能性があります。設定ミスを防ぐために、ネットワークパラメータを慎重に確認し、ドキュメントに記録しておくことが重要です。
3.2 サイクルタイムの設定不適切
ETCは、リアルタイム性を実現するために、サイクルタイムを設定します。サイクルタイムが長すぎると、リアルタイム性が損なわれ、制御の遅延が発生する可能性があります。一方、サイクルタイムが短すぎると、CPU負荷が高くなり、システムの安定性が損なわれる可能性があります。システムの要件に合わせて、適切なサイクルタイムを設定する必要があります。
3.3 診断機能の活用不足
ETCシステムには、診断機能が搭載されています。診断機能を使用すると、ネットワークの状態、通信エラー、デバイスの故障などを確認することができます。診断機能を活用することで、問題の早期発見と解決が可能になります。定期的に診断機能を使用し、システムの健全性を確認することが重要です。
4. 運用・保守体制の不備
ETCシステムを安定的に運用するためには、適切な運用・保守体制を構築する必要があります。不十分な運用・保守体制は、システムのダウンタイムを増加させ、生産性の低下を招く可能性があります。
4.1 定期的なバックアップの欠如
ETCシステムの構成データやパラメータは、定期的にバックアップする必要があります。バックアップがない場合、システムに障害が発生した場合、復旧に時間がかかり、生産性の低下を招く可能性があります。自動バックアップ機能を活用し、定期的にバックアップを行うことが重要です。
4.2 障害発生時の対応遅延
ETCシステムに障害が発生した場合、迅速に対応する必要があります。対応が遅れると、ダウンタイムが長くなり、生産性の低下を招く可能性があります。障害発生時の対応手順を事前に策定し、担当者を明確にしておくことが重要です。また、メーカーのサポート体制を活用し、迅速な復旧を目指すことが望ましいです。
4.3 ソフトウェアアップデートの遅延
ETCシステムのソフトウェアは、定期的にアップデートされます。ソフトウェアアップデートには、セキュリティの強化、バグの修正、新機能の追加などが含まれます。ソフトウェアアップデートを遅延させると、セキュリティリスクが高まり、システムの安定性が損なわれる可能性があります。定期的にソフトウェアアップデートを確認し、最新の状態に保つことが重要です。
5. セキュリティ対策の不備
ETCネットワークは、産業用ネットワークであるため、セキュリティ対策が重要です。不十分なセキュリティ対策は、不正アクセスや情報漏洩のリスクを高めます。
5.1 アクセス制御の不備
ETCネットワークへのアクセスは、許可されたユーザーのみに制限する必要があります。アクセス制御が不十分な場合、不正アクセスが発生し、システムの制御を奪われる可能性があります。強力なパスワードを設定し、アクセス権限を適切に管理することが重要です。
5.2 ファイアウォールの導入不足
ETCネットワークと外部ネットワークとの間には、ファイアウォールを導入し、不正なアクセスを遮断する必要があります。ファイアウォールを導入することで、外部からの攻撃を防ぎ、システムのセキュリティを強化することができます。
5.3 脆弱性情報の監視不足
ETCシステムで使用されているソフトウェアやハードウェアには、脆弱性が存在する可能性があります。脆弱性情報は、定期的に監視し、適切な対策を講じる必要があります。メーカーから提供されるセキュリティ情報を確認し、最新のパッチを適用することが重要です。
まとめ
イーサクラシック(ETC)の取引における失敗は、事前調査・要件定義の不備、ハードウェア選定の誤り、ソフトウェア設定の不備、運用・保守体制の不備、セキュリティ対策の不備など、多岐にわたります。これらの失敗を防ぐためには、専門的な知識と経験に基づいた適切な対策を講じることが重要です。本稿で解説した内容を参考に、ETCシステムの導入、設定、運用において、十分な注意を払い、安全で信頼性の高いシステムを構築してください。継続的な学習と情報収集も、ETCシステムの成功に不可欠です。